Romania; Third Review Under the Stand-By Arrangement—Staff Report; Staff Supplement; Press Release on the Executive Board Discussion; and Statement by the Executive Director for Romania.
This paper discusses key findings of the Third Review of Romania’s economic performance under a program supported by a 24-month Stand-By Arrangement (SBA). The authorities are on track to achieve their 2011–12 deficit targets, but stepped-up efforts are needed on key structural reforms. Inflation has dropped sharply, reflecting food prices deflation and the removal of the VAT base effect. All end-September quantitative performance criteria and indicative targets were met, and inflation returned to the inner band of the inflation consultation mechanism.
